How can digital currencies protect against a potential dollar collapse scenario?
In the event of a potential dollar collapse, how can digital currencies provide protection and stability? What mechanisms or features do digital currencies have that make them resilient to such scenarios?

- loki45Oct 03, 2022 · 3 years agoDigital currencies, like Bitcoin, can act as a store of value and a hedge against inflation, making them an attractive option in a potential dollar collapse scenario. Unlike fiat currencies, which can be subject to inflationary pressures due to government policies, digital currencies have a limited supply. For example, Bitcoin has a maximum supply of 21 million coins, which means it cannot be inflated at the whim of a central authority. This scarcity can help protect against the erosion of purchasing power that often accompanies a collapse in the value of a fiat currency. Additionally, the decentralized nature of digital currencies ensures that they are not dependent on any single government or financial institution, further enhancing their resilience in a dollar collapse scenario.
